About
"Red Line" (2023) is an intriguing indie RPG that combines elements of adventure and mystery. Players step into the shoes of a brooding girl who uncovers a notebook that connects her to alternate realities, leading to a suspenseful journey through time. This unique premise sets "Red Line" apart, offering a narrative-rich experience that encourages exploration and discovery while navigating through sinister environments.
